0402YD105KAT4A

Introducing the 0402YD105KAT4A, the latest cutting-edge electronic component that guarantees superior performance and reliability for your electronic designs. This multi-layer ceramic capacitor (MLCC) is an essential component for a wide range of applications. With a capacitance of 1µF and a voltage rating of 16V, the 0402YD105KAT4A is designed to handle high-frequency and high-power applications with ease, ensuring stable and uninterrupted performance. Its small 0402 package size allows for compact circuit designs while providing exceptional capacitance. Featuring low ESR (Equivalent Series Resistance) and ESL (Equivalent Series Inductance), this MLCC delivers excellent signal integrity, minimizing any signal loss or distortion and resulting in better system efficiency. Moreover, its high capacitance value ensures that it can handle demanding electrical loads with minimal voltage drops, improving the overall performance and longevity of your electronic systems. The 0402YD105KAT4A is RoHS compliant and is manufactured using high-quality materials, ensuring durability and long-term reliability.
